exploitation in Greek is εκμετάλλευση — exploitation means the unfair use of someone or something for personal gain.
exploitation in Greek
εκμετάλλευση
Pronounced: ekmetallefsi
What does "exploitation" mean?
-
noun The unfair use of someone or something for personal gain.
"The report exposed the exploitation of migrant workers."
-
noun The act of making practical use of something, such as a resource.
"The exploitation of natural gas reserves boosted the economy."
